1956 AC Ace vs. 1977 Zastava 1500

To start off, 1977 Zastava 1500 is newer by 21 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1956 AC Ace.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1956 AC Ace would be higher. At 1,971 cc (6 cylinders), 1956 AC Ace is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 1956 AC Ace (123 HP @ 6000 RPM) has 49 more horse power than 1977 Zastava 1500. (74 HP @ 5400 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 1956 AC Ace should accelerate faster than 1977 Zastava 1500.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 1977 Zastava 1500 weights approximately 66 kg more than 1956 AC Ace.

Let's talk about torque, 1956 AC Ace (167 Nm) has 54 more torque (in Nm) than 1977 Zastava 1500. (113 Nm). This means 1956 AC Ace will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1977 Zastava 1500.

Compare all specifications:

1956 AC Ace 1977 Zastava 1500
Make AC Zastava
Model Ace 1500
Year Released 1956 1977
Engine Size 1971 cc 1481 cc
Engine Cylinders 6 cylinders 4 cylinders
Engine Type in-line in-line
Horse Power 123 HP 74 HP
Engine RPM 6000 RPM 5400 RPM
Torque 167 Nm 113 Nm
Fuel Type Gasoline Gasoline
Transmission Type Manual Manual
Vehicle Weight 894 kg 960 kg
Vehicle Length 3850 mm 4040 mm
Vehicle Width 1520 mm 1550 mm
Vehicle Height 1250 mm 1450 mm
Wheelbase Size 2290 mm 2430 mm
